Route: Split - Makarska - Mljet - Dubrovnik - Šipan/Trstenik - Korčula - Hvar - (Bol) Split
Check in between 11:00-12:00. At 13:00 depart from Split Harbour (late arrivals can join in Makarska) heading south, towards Makarska. Lunch is served while cruising along the Dalmatian coast. Afternoon swim-stop in one of the secluded bays en route. For the adrenaline lovers, there’s an optional zipline ride over the Cetina river canyon (not included). Enjoy Makarska in the evening. Stroll the waterfront with its wide promenade, a pathway out to a lighthouse and some cool bars. The main square is home to an impressive church and other monuments and sights. Overnight in the port of Makarska.
Meals included: Lunch
Early morning departure to the island of Mljet. Swim-stop on the Pelješac Penninsula. Part of Mljet Island is a national park (entrance fee EUR 20 per person to be paid on spot; not included). In the afternoon, visit seawater lakes, the peaceful, tiny St Mary’s Island in the middle of the large lake, the church and the monastery. Walk or hire a bike to explore these stunning lakes. Overnight in the port of Polača or Pomena.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
After breakfast, depart for Dubrovnik, the most famous town in Croatia and, for many, the highlight of this cruise. The Irish writer George Bernard Shaw called Dubrovnik “Heaven on Earth”. Unbelievable views of the surroundings along the way, enjoy and admire the beautiful stretch of the coast. Upon arrival, explore on your own or join a guided city tour (included on Premium and Premium Superior), followed by an optional cable car ride up to the Srđ mountain for spectacular views of the old town. Don’t miss Stradun - both a street and a square in the Old Town and walk at least part of the 1.940 m long city walls which have protected Dubrovnik during earthquakes and attacks! Overnight in the port of this magical town.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
Late morning departure towards the island of Šipan or the small town of Trstenik on the Pelješac Peninsula. Gorgeous spots for an afternoon swim and time at leisure with the possibility to visit a local winery. Overnight in the port.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
After breakfast, departure towards the island of Korčula, one of the famous islands in the Dubrovnik region. It’s the birthplace of the explorer Marco Polo. Lunch on board in a bay near the Korčula town. The encircling town walls and bastions date back to the 13th Century and there are some lovely churches and museums. Join the optional sightseeing of the Korčula town (included on Premium Superior) or optional wine and local appetizer tasting (not included) at a local winery before dining in one of the numerous seafront restaurants or konobas on your own. Overnight in the port of Korčula.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
Early departure towards the Paklinski Islands near Hvar (the longest island in the Adriatic) for lunch and a swimming stop. Later, there’s an optional afternoon sightseeing of Hvar (included on Premium Superior), which resembles a film set. The Renaissance cathedral has its original tower and the oldest community theatre in Europe, founded in 1612. Hvar is known as a jet-set island, offering abundant entertainment, excellent restaurants, bars and cafés serving drinks long into the night. Don`t forget to buy some island lavender from local stalls. Overnight in Hvar.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
The next stop is the island of Brač. The most famous (and most photographed) beach in Dalmatia is Zlatni Rat (Golden Horn) near Bol - famous for its everchanging shape - a shingle bar that moves according to the wind. Great place for a swim stop. Bol is a typical fishermen’s village that kept the atmosphere despite becoming a popular touristic spot. After lunch, on the way to Split, it is possible to join the optional river rafting excursion on the Cetina river (not included). The approach to the Split Riviera is wonderful and offers the best views from onboard. Upon arrival, join the optional guided tour of Split (at own cost), a monumental city which together with the famous Roman Diocletian’s Palace is under UNESCO protection. Split is full of bistros and restaurants serving local specialities. Cool bars, too.
Meals included: Breakfast, Lunch
An early breakfast before the final goodbyes to the new friends and crew and check-out at 09:00.
Meals included: Breakfast

Traditional ensuite:
Traditional wooden vessels featuring air-conditioned cabins with private shower/toilet, mostly bunk beds, air-conditioned salon.
Choose between under deck cabins or on deck cabins. Cabins are mostly bunk beds and include ensuite shower/toilet.
"On deck" cabins can be situated on the main deck (deck on which you step on as you embark the ship ) and on the upper deck (deck on top of the main deck). "Under deck" cabins can be found below deck and are actually in the hull of the boat. Advantage of cabins situated on deck is the direct exit to the sea and more fresh air, while cabins below deck are sometimes more quiet (only fellow passengers who have booked below deck cabins will pass by and not all passengers from your ship as well as other ships when docked) and comfortable because they're situated in a sea level that chills cabins and hallways below deck. Cabins below deck mostly have little portholes.
The crew does not enter your cabins during the cruise, so you need to keep your cabin clean by yourself.
Cabins are air-conditioned, and salons and hallways below deck usually have air conditioning. Air conditioning is turned on only while the motor or generator works, or while the boat is connected to electricity in harbor. If the boat is docked at sea or in a smaller fish harbor that doesn't have an electricity plug, air conditioning is turned off, because otherwise the generator would disturb the peace and quiet.

For the duration of the cruise you will be on one of our boats. All our boats are motor boats made of wood or iron. Boats are different sizes and shapes and we do not know which boat you will be one until 2 weeks before departure. Boat owners are mostly captains for whom this job is a part of a family tradition, so it’s not rare that the crew members are part of one family. Depending on its size, your boat will have about five crew members. Usually that means a captain, a chef, a waiter and deck hands.

Some meals are included:
Continental breakfast and 3-course lunch, as well as complimentary water, is included daily.
Food onboard is similar to traditional Croatian food. Breakfast is a continental breakfast, and consists of tea and coffee, fruit juice, bread, butter, jam, and sometimes ham and cheese. Lunch is traditionally plentiful. It consists of soup or pasta as starter, a main dish with side dishes, salad and dessert. Main dish is two or three times weekly a fish, and in other cases meat or chicken. Side dishes are potatoes, cabbage and other vegetables. Dessert is fruit or cake. Dinner is not included because we encourage you to explore local restaurants.
